SMALL BUSINESSES MAKE MAJOR IMPACT
Shopping small business is BIG for our community. When we buy local, that money stays local.
Small businesses and entrepreneurship fuel our economy, resulting in essential growth. Did you know: small businesses have created over 66% of all new jobs since 1995? The more we shop at a local store, the more potential job opportunities we could help them provide. It’s also estimated that when we buy from independent, locally-owned businesses, more than 65% of our money will stay right here, in our own community.
When you buy from a small business, often you’re supporting a family. You’re the reason a family is able to put food on their table, pay their mortgage, or send children to college. You’re supporting individuals with a high level of ethics, who treat their employees like family.
Small businesses also tend to be more involved in the local community. Besides providing us with the goods or services we purchase, small businesses give back. The money we spend with local businesses indirectly puts money into community events, sports teams, and fundraisers that are often sponsored by these businesses. Likewise, business owners are often heavily involved in the community serving on boards and committees and volunteering time to projects and improvements that benefit us all.
UNIQUE ITEMS & PERSONALIZED SERVICES
Sure, you can find nice gifts at the big box stores, but you certainly won’t find any one-of-a-kind treasures. Many local retailers pride themselves on offering unique, specialty items. Small businesses can offer a more enjoyable shopping experience that allows time for more thoughtful browsing and exploring. You may also be surprised at the exceptional level of personalized customer service you’ll receive.
Small business owners (and their staff) often have more knowledge of the products and services they’re selling. Many small business owners fill every role within their business, including customer service. To them, every customer truly matters.
